News Zhang Xiaogang Receives Honorary Doctorate Philadelphia University of the Arts Congratulations to Chinese artist Zhang Xiaogang on his recent Honorary Doctorate from Philadelphia's University of the Arts. David Yager, the University's President and CEO, delivered the honor to Zhang on May 16 in recognition of his contributions to Chinese contemporary art.Born in Kunming China in 1958, Zhang came to prominence in the 1990s amid the new wave of Chinese artists breaking from aesthetic traditions. Playing off the conventions of state-sponsored Socialist Realism and inspired by Surrealism, he navigates the cultural terrain of contemporary China with works that question notions of identity and the construction of memory.
